+1 for me as well. I set the "fully open at this location" in my garage and manually set the max height for the trunk as well and it never opens fully in my garage even though there is sufficient clearance.

Here's a work around, although it requires an additional step: 1) If your trunk doesn't open to it's pre-set height, wait for it to open then 2) Click (do not hold) the "open trunk" button on the trunk again, this will override the overrhead sensors and open fully.
 
Same behavior with our MX. When the car is in the garage, the FWD’s and trunk door only open partially. An arc shaped line can be seen on the “doors” diagram of the MCU. If I back the car out, the doors still only open part way. The only way to have the door open fully is to leave the house completely, drive around and then come bank. If I don’t pull in the garage, the doors will open fully. The minute I pull in, back to partial opening. I believe this behavior is related to GPS based door positions.
